Abstract/Summary:
The American Nativism Movement is a movement in the history of the United States,which has a history of more than 170 years,taking the thought of exclusion as its theoretical basis and maintaining the mainstream culture of white Americans as its main goal.Its main task is to oppose immigrants from Catholicism,Judaism,Asia and Latin immigrants.The American Protective Association,founded in 1887 in Clinton Town,Iowa,is an influential nativist organization in the late 19 th century.It opposes immigration,foreign church forces,and supports non-denominational public schools,which has set off another anti-Catholic frenzy in the society.This thesis consists of three parts: introduction,text and conclusion.The text is divided into four chapters.The first chapter mainly introduces the background of the establishment of the American Protective Association.The American Nativism Movement has a long history.As an extremely important nativism organization at the end of the 19 th century,the American Protective Association inherited part of the concept and organizational structure of the "ignorant party",which is the inheritance and development of previous nativism activities.In the 1980 s,the influx of "new immigrants" aggravated the contradiction between the natives and immigrants,and the social xenophobia became more serious;The controversy between Protestant and Catholic schools and the serious economic crisis have provided a favorable social environment for the establishment of the American Protective Association.It is under the comprehensive effect of the above factors that the American Protective Association has been continuously bred,and entered people’s vision with the goal of being loyal to the American way of life and opposing foreign church forces.The second chapter discusses the establishment and preliminary development of the American Protective Association.With the efforts of Henry F.Bowers,the American Protective Association was formally established in 1887,and quickly drafted the articles of association,the relevant provisions of the admission ceremony,and the objectives and principles of the organization.After its establishment,the Association actively improved its organizational structure,expanded its influence and launched a ruthless attack on Catholicism.The third chapter discusses the struggle between the American Protective Association and Catholicism in detail.Due to the outbreak of the economic crisis and the strong anti-Catholic atmosphere in the society,the activities of the American Protective Association reached its peak.The activities of the American Protective Association mainly include: distribution of fabricated leaflets,distribution of newspapers,"Whisper Campaign",public speeches,funding of priests and fugitive nuns,etc.The Association maintains anti-Catholic enthusiasm through the combination of openness and concealment,and internal and external means.Taking the statue of Father Marquette,the event of Father York in San Francisco and the Spreckles scandal as examples,this thesis shows the process of the struggle between the American Protective Association and the Catholic Church.The fourth chapter introduces the decline of the American Protective Association,and summarizes and evaluates it.There were conflicts within the American Protective Association on the William Mc Kinley incident and the silver issue.With the change of the social environment and the division of the senior management of the Association,the Association gradually declined.The characteristic of the American Protective Association is that it relies on rhetoric propaganda to carry out anti-Catholic activities and advocates loyalty to the true American spirit.The American Protective Association attacks Catholicism on the basis that Roman Catholics’ loyalty to the Pope is higher than the obedience and loyalty required by the United States of America,Catholics should control the government in the name of the Pope,and American Protestant civilians have patriotic obligations.The American Protective Association,as a connecting chapter in the American nativism movement,has the nature of anti-immigration and protecting the American economy.From another perspective,it is also an organization with the nature of religious extremism,which has a profound impact on American society.Based on the analysis of the development process of the American Protective Association,this thesis tries to present the complete picture of its activities from 1887 to 1897.Finally,it is concluded that the issue of immigration is closely related to nativism.In order to overcome the impact of nativism,we must deal with the issue of immigration,expand the publicity of immigrants’ contributions in economic,social and cultural aspects,and arouse the resonance of the American people.The anti-Catholic activities of the American Protective Association are a destruction of American freedom and democracy,causing social panic and will be eliminated by history.To prevent the resurgence of nationalism,a complex multi-pronged approach needs to be adopted,including long-term political mobilization and more active public discussion on the issue of migration and globalization.
